7 Sights to See at the Exhibition of National Economy Achievements
October 28, 2020 19:17


Over 60 years ago, on June 16, 1959, the Exhibition of National Economy Achievements (ENEA) was opened to public in Moscow. The grand-scale project embodied a variety of cultural characteristics of the Soviet era, being a kind of open-air museum of the history of the USSR and Russia.
So what should you pay attention to when on your first visit here?
Amusement Park
The ENEA Amusement Park is one of the few attractions of ENEA that has retained its identity for several decades. There used to be 2 amusement parks at VDNKh. Now the amusement park is located only on the left side from the main entrance. In the future, though, the second amusement park is planned to be restored on the right side of the ENEA square.
Gold Fountain "The Friendship of Peoples"
The Friendship of Peoples fountain is a landmark sight at the ENEA and one of the symbols of Moscow. It was constructed in 1954 and features gilded sculptures of 16 girls wearing national dresses of 16 union republics of the USSR that they symbolize. In the evenings, the fountain gets illuminated in different colors, which change 16 times in 1 hour.
Cinema "Circular Kinopanorama"
This is the world's only cinema where visitors can watch unique 360-degree films with stereo sound.These films are usually about 20 minutes long. 22 screens installed in 2 tiers form a circle, which creates a completely realistic effect of presence for each visitor.

The Cosmonautics Museum
The first manned flight into space was one of the most important stages in the development of science in the Soviet Union and one of the most important world achievements. In the museum you can see things related to space and astronauts in one way or another: space equipment, the first spacesuits and artificial satellites of the Earth - everything that helped to study the Moon and other planets of the solar system. Now there are more than 90 thousand exhibits: these are samples of rocket and space machinery as well as rarities, documents, arts and crafts, paintings and many others.

Moscow House of Butterflies
The Butterfly House in Pavilion 519 is the place you must definitely visit at the ENEA! The Butterfly House has 2 halls.Greenhouse ¹ 1 is an exhibition with live tropical butterflies. Here you can see different types of butterflies and even touch them!
In hall 2 you will see a gallery with a unique private collection of butterflies and various insects from all over the world. This collection is trully unparalleled.

Moskvarium
Moskvarium is divided into several zones: an aquarium zone, a swimming center with dolphins, and a lecture hall.In the aquarium area there are about 8 thousand marine and freshwater inhabitants from all over the world. Here you can find stingrays, crustaceans, and various types of fish, as well as starfish, octopuses,sharks and cayman crocodiles. You can swim with dolphins in the Moskvarium. Seals, majestic killer whales, mysterious beluga whales and, of course, mischievous dolphins will gladly show you everything they can do!
